- Structure Name: Coruscant Biodome
- Classification: Man-made biodome
- Location: Coruscant - New Jedi Temple
- Affiliation: The Galactic Alliance/New Jedi Order
- Accessibility: While the structure is publicly visible, it is only accessible through the temple itself. Only Jedi and approved personnel are permitted inside, and only Jedi with special clearance can access certain restricted areas.
- Description: The Coruscant Biodome is a large, geodesic dome-shaped building attached to the Coruscant Jedi temple. This building is home to many species of flora (and some fauna) collected from all over the galaxy, which exist within a self-contained, self-sustaining, man-made environment. The biodome is divided into multiple sections, each dedicated to the specific needs of a particular ecosystem.

Organic Archive - Each sample is catalogued regarding its appearance, habitat, and various properties. This information is stored in the organic archive, which is accessible to all Jedi. The restricted section of the archive, which contains sensitive information, can only be accessed by Jedi with authorization.
Seed Vaults - These vaults contain duplicate seeds for each species of flora that occupies the biodome. The seed vaults are under heavy surveillance and guarded by security droids or other personnel. Restricted to authorized personnel only.
Meditation Garden - On the first floor of the biome is a meditation garden accessible to all Jedi. This garden is beautifully maintained, and provides a peaceful, tranquil location for Jedi to meditate and reflect. Bota flowers, which have been said to strengthen a Jedi's connection to the Force, are planted here.

Each biome has been carefully constructed to simulate the ecosystem it is modeled after. Because some of these environments are extreme (blistering deserts, icy tundras, etc.), they are sometimes used to train a Jedi's resilience against the elements. Most of the biomes are accessible to all Jedi, though some of the smaller, more particular biomes containing rare or dangerous life are restricted. Certain fauna, when deemed necessary to the balance of an ecosystem, are introduced. Caretakers of these biomes are often Jedi with an affinity for nature, though some are assigned to the biodome as a form of punishment.
All visitors, Jedi or civilian, are cautioned to treat the plants and animals within the biodome with respect. Failure to do so will result in immediate disciplinary action.
In addition to various biomes, the biodome also contains an 'organic archive', or catalogue of information regarding a particular species of plant. The biodome also houses a seed vault, which contains duplicates for all seeds. When a planet's ecosystem is disrupted due to galactic war or natural events, the seed vault comes in handy in restoring the native flora.
